平台工程动态 Monthly News 2023-11
了解最新行业动态,洞察平台工程本质。
TOC
项目与社区动态
CNCF 云原生技术全景图 v2
2023 平台工程调研报告
CNCF App Delivery TAG 发布中文网站
CNCF 平台工程成熟度模型发布
Humanitec 发布平台工程现状报告
Gartner: 中国的平台工程正处于萌芽期
CNCF PaaP 工作组正在起草「平台即产品」白皮书
HashiCorp 发布平台团队最佳实践
会议与活动
GitHub Universe 2023 回顾
KubeCon + CloudNativeCon Europe 2024 将在巴黎召开
TOP100 全球软件研发案例峰会设置平台工程专题
优质好文推荐
8 Essential Metrics to Measure Developer Productivity in 2023
Pravanjan Choudhury 的平台工程主题的系列文章
平台工程:减少认知负荷,提高开发者生产力
通过平台工程与自服务工具为开发者赋能
将 FinOps、DevOps 和平台工程结合在一起
视频与播客
How to get platform engineering on their radar
Cognitive Load and Platforms
图书
Platform Engineering: What You Need to Know Now
Platform Strategy: Innovation Through Harmonization
项目与社区动态
CNCF 云原生技术全景图 v2
CNCF 正计划在年底前发布云原生技术全景图 v2,更快更易用
云原生技术全景图 预览地址1
2023 平台工程调研报告
Platform Engineering 社区:2023 平台工程调研报告2
欢迎参与中文本地化翻译工作:
CNCF App Delivery TAG 发布中文网站
CNCF App Delivery TAG 中文网站3
CNCF 平台工程成熟度模型发布
CNCF 平台工程成熟度模型4
平台白皮书中文版正在提交到上游发布至中文网站。
Humanitec 发布平台工程现状报告
State of Platform Engineering Report Volume 15
State of Platform Engineering Report Volume 26
Gartner: 中国的平台工程正处于萌芽期
Gartner 于近日最新发布 2023 年中国信息与通信技术成熟度曲线,该曲线显示中国的平台工程 正处于萌芽期。
微信文章:2023 年中国信息与通信技术成熟度曲线7
CNCF PaaP 工作组正在起草「平台即产品」白皮书
CNCF TAG App Delivery - PaaP WG 正在起草 平台即产品白皮书
Platform as a Product
Introduction
Adopting a Product Mindset
Developing a Platform Strategy
Organizational Transformation
Delivering the Platform
Glossary
HashiCorp 发布平台团队最佳实践
Platform Teams Best Practices8
该白皮书详细介绍了云技术应用的各个阶段、平台团队所扮演的角色,以及如何建立和确保这些团队及其创建的平台取得成功。
Contents
Executive Summary
The 3 phases of cloud adoption
Phase 1: Adopting — an ad hoc approach to cloud
Phase 2: Standardizing Platform as a service
Phase 3: Scaling Hybrid and multi-cloud platforms
Platform teams bring order to chaos
What’s in scope for platform teams?
Platform teams accelerate cloud adoption
Enterprise platform capabilities
Platform team best practices
Considerations when establishing a platform and platform team
Organizational considerations of platform teams
Ensuring adoption and success
The value of platform teams
Conclusion and next steps
会议与活动
GitHub Universe 2023 回顾
DEV2173G: Driving organizational sustainability with platform engineering9
DEV2882L: Platform engineering: a new idea or just a new name?10
DEV2891D: Platform engineering made easy: Octopus Deploy’s answer to DevEx11
DEV2197G: Built with ❤️: Why developer experience matters12
KubeCon + CloudNativeCon Europe 2024 将在巴黎召开
KubeCon + CloudNativeCon Europe 除设置 Platform Engineering 专题外,还额外有同场活动:Platform Engineering Day。
Platform Engineering Day 包括以下主题:
Improving platform maturity
Using platforms to drive developer experience
Platform product management practices
Measuring platform success
Designing paved paths
Building platforms for day 2 operations
Investing in platforms
Platform team composition
Platform adoption stories
Examples of internal platform evangelism
KubeCon + CloudNativeCon Europe 2023 活动主页13
TOP100 全球软件研发案例峰会设置平台工程专题
全球软件案例研究峰会是科技界一年一度的案例研究榜单,旨在发现有案例教学意义的项目或方法论。
本次大会将于 2023 年 12 月 16 日在北京市朝阳区国际会议中心召开,设置有「提升规模化效能的平台工程」专题。
TOP100 峰会平台工程专题14
优质好文推荐
8 Essential Metrics to Measure Developer Productivity in 2023
文章:8 Essential Metrics to Measure Developer Productivity in 202315
Table of Contents
What is developer productivity?
Why do companies measure developers' productivity?
Resource Allocation and Management
Identifying Strengths and Weaknesses
Setting Realistic Goals and Expectations
Tracking Progress and Improvement
Demonstrating Value to Stakeholders
Why is prioritizing your to-do list essential?
How do you measure a developer's productivity?
Efficiency
Code churn
Lead time
Cycle time
Activity
Communication and collaboration
Mean time to recover (MTTR)
Job satisfaction and well-being
Barriers to Developer Productivity and Effective Strategies for Improvement
Barriers to Developer Productivity
Ways to Improve Developer Productivity
Measuring Developer Productivity
Best Practices for Measuring Developer Productivity
Tools to Measure Developer Productivity
Project management tools
Collaboration tools
Employee engagement tool
Conclusion
Pravanjan Choudhury 的平台工程主题的系列文章
Part 1: Evolving DevOps: Platform Engineering Takes Center Stage16
Part 2: The DevOps Future Is User-Centric Platform Engineering17
Part 3: Shaping DevOps with the Best of ‘By Audit’ and ‘By Design’18
Part 4: Cloud Portability: How Platform Engineering Pushes Past Toil19
Part 5: How Platform Engineering Can Help Keep Cloud Costs in Check20
Part 6: Making the Leap: Ops Roles Evolve into Platform Engineers21
Part 7: Platform Engineering, Yes/No? A Guide to Making the Call22
Part 8: Measuring Key KPIs and Platform Engineering Success23
Part 9: Bringing Harmony to Chaos: A Dive into Standardization24
Part 10: Platform Engineering — Navigating Today, Forecasting Tomorrow25
作者:Pravanjan Choudhury
Pravanjan Choudhury is the CEO and co-founder of Facets, a self-serve DevOps automation platform that helps companies adopt platform engineering practices. With over 19 years of experience, Pravanjan has worked on diverse technology platforms, ranging from embedded systems to cloud-based products. During his last tenure as a CTO, he successfully led multiple acquisitions and effectively scaled technology teams. He holds a Ph.D. in computer science and enjoys playing badminton in his leisure time.
平台工程:减少认知负荷,提高开发者生产力
平台工程:减少认知负荷,提高开发者生产力26
介绍:平台工程是为自助服务功能设计和构建工具链和工作流的实践,以降低软件开发的复杂性。
通过平台工程与自服务工具为开发者赋能
通过平台工程与自服务工具为开发者赋能27
介绍:应用程序开发团队最常想要的是能够提高速度和自主性的工具。不仅要减少构建、测试和部署的摩擦,还要能够了解其应用程序中发生的情况。
将 FinOps、DevOps 和平台工程结合在一起
Bringing together FinOps, DevOps, and platform engineering28
作者:Ajay Chankramath, Head of Platform Engineering at ThoughtWorks North America
Discover how to achieve cloud cost efficiency through the power of platforms, by combining proven and efficient engineering practices. Ajay Chankramath, Head of Platform Engineering at ThoughtWorks North America
视频与播客
How to get platform engineering on their radar
视频:Hacking your manager - how to get platform engineering on their radar29
Cognitive Load and Platforms
播客节目主题:Cognitive Load and Platforms30
节目大纲:
The Concept of Cognitive Load in Platforms
The Purpose of Platforms in IT
Managing Complexity in Platforms
Practical Implications of Understanding Cognitive Load
Cognitive Load and Its Impact on Problem-Solving and Decision-Making
The Balance Between Experience and Innovation
图书
Platform Engineering: What You Need to Know Now
电子书:平台工程必知必会31
PDF 下载:平台工程必知必会32
Platform Strategy: Innovation Through Harmonization
新书出版:Platform Strategy: Innovation Through Harmonization33
作者:Gregor Hohpe 是 PlatformCon 的演讲嘉宾,在 YouTube 上有许多不错的视频。
Gregor Hohpe 为 CTO 和高级 IT 主管提供 IT 战略、云架构和组织转型方面的建议。他曾担任新加坡政府顾问、安联集团首席架构师、谷歌云 CTO 办公室技术总监。
Table of Contents
Part I: Understanding Platforms
Standing on the Shoulders of Giants
The Fab Four of Technology Platforms
Part II: A Strategy for Platforms
Formulating a Strategy
Becoming a Platform Company
Mapping Platforms
The Platform Paradox
Addendum: “I ACED My Strategy”
Part III: In-House Platforms
In-House IT Platforms
IT Platform and IT Services Org Are Antonyms
Mechanisms not Magic
Do You Have an Opinion? A mind of your own?
Making Platform Decisions
Procuring a Platform
Part IV: Designing Platforms
The 7 “C“s of Platform Quality
Fruit Salad or Fruit Basket?
Will Your Platform Float or Sink?
Beware the Grim Wrapper!
Build Abstractions, Not Illusions
Failure Doesn’t Respect Abstraction
Part V: Implementing Platforms
Platform Anatomy
Platform Implementation Choices
Part VI: Growing Platforms
The Cube: Three Dimensions of Platform Evolution
The Shape of Platforms
Part VII: Organizing for Platforms
Platform, Inc.
Rolling out a Developer Platform
The Customer-Centric Platform Team
Platform Teams Without Platform
参考资料
云原生技术全景图预览地址 - https://cncf.landscape2.io
Platform Engineering 社区:2023 平台工程调研报告 - https://platformengineering.org/blog/results-are-in-the-2023-platform-engineering-survey
CNCF App Delivery TAG 中文网站 - https://tag-app-delivery.cncf.io/zh/
CNCF 平台工程成熟度模型 - https://tag-app-delivery.cncf.io/whitepapers/platform-eng-maturity-model/
State of Platform Engineering Report Volume 1 - https://humanitec.com/whitepapers/state-of-platform-engineering-report-volume-1
State of Platform Engineering Report Volume 2 - https://humanitec.com/whitepapers/state-of-platform-engineering-report-volume-2
微信文章:2023 年中国信息与通信技术成熟度曲线 - https://mp.weixin.qq.com/s/zxw3UFb0oy3vKTou2ZaTJg
Platform Teams Best Practices - https://www.hashicorp.com/resources/platform-teams-best-practices
DEV2173G: Driving organizational sustainability with platform engineering - https://reg.githubuniverse.com/flow/github/universe23/sessioncatalog/page/sessioncatalog/session/1686444082467001GFo7
DEV2882L: Platform engineering: a new idea or just a new name? - https://reg.githubuniverse.com/flow/github/universe23/sessioncatalog/page/sessioncatalog/session/1698054675283001a1yL
DEV2891D: Platform engineering made easy: Octopus Deploy’s answer to DevEx - https://reg.githubuniverse.com/flow/github/universe23/sessioncatalog/page/sessioncatalog/session/1698305589636001ialV
DEV2197G: Built with ❤️: Why developer experience matters - https://reg.githubuniverse.com/flow/github/universe23/sessioncatalog/page/sessioncatalog/session/1686490376577001nn5j
KubeCon + CloudNativeCon Europe 2023 活动主页 - https://events.linuxfoundation.org/kubecon-cloudnativecon-europe/co-located-events/platform-engineering-day/
TOP100 峰会平台工程专题 - https://www.top100summit.com/Project_detail?id=5880
文章:8 Essential Metrics to Measure Developer Productivity in 2023 - https://www.turing.com/resources/how-to-measure-developer-productivity
Evolving DevOps: Platform Engineering Takes Center Stage - https://thenewstack.io/evolving-devops-platform-engineering-takes-center-stage/
The DevOps Future Is User-Centric Platform Engineering - https://thenewstack.io/the-devops-future-is-user-centric-platform-engineering/
Shaping DevOps with the Best of ‘By Audit’ and ‘By Design’ - https://thenewstack.io/shaping-devops-with-the-best-of-by-audit-and-by-design/
Cloud Portability: How Platform Engineering Pushes Past Toil - https://thenewstack.io/cloud-portability-how-platform-engineering-pushes-past-toil/
How Platform Engineering Can Help Keep Cloud Costs in Check - https://thenewstack.io/how-platform-engineering-can-help-keep-cloud-costs-in-check/
Making the Leap: Ops Roles Evolve into Platform Engineers - https://thenewstack.io/making-the-leap-ops-roles-evolve-into-platform-engineers/
Platform Engineering, Yes/No? A Guide to Making the Call - https://thenewstack.io/platform-engineering-yes-no-a-guide-to-making-the-call/
Measuring Key KPIs and Platform Engineering Success - https://thenewstack.io/measuring-key-kpis-and-platform-engineering-success/
Bringing Harmony to Chaos: A Dive into Standardization - https://thenewstack.io/bringing-harmony-to-chaos-a-dive-into-standardization/
Platform Engineering — Navigating Today, Forecasting Tomorrow - https://thenewstack.io/platform-engineering-navigating-today-forecasting-tomorrow/
平台工程:减少认知负荷,提高开发者生产力 - https://thenewstack.io/platform-engineering-reduces-cognitive-load-and-raises-developer-productivity/
通过平台工程与自服务工具为开发者赋能 - https://thenewstack.io/developer-empowerment-via-platform-engineering-self-service-tooling/
Bringing together FinOps, DevOps, and platform engineering - https://platformengineering.org/blog/bringing-together-finops-devops-and-platform-engineering
视频:Hacking your manager - how to get platform engineering on their radar - https://www.youtube.com/watch?v=Iw-3bbd6f8w
Cognitive Load and Platforms - https://packetpushers.net/podcast/hs059-cognitive-load-and-platforms/
电子书:平台工程必知必会 - https://thenewstack.io/new-ebook-free-platform-engineering-guide/
PDF 下载:平台工程必知必会 - https://dl.thenewstack.io/ebooks/series12/TheNewStack_PlatformEngineering_WhatYouNeedtoKnowNow.pdf
新书出版:Platform Strategy: Innovation Through Harmonization - https://leanpub.com/platformstrategy
For Platformers !
了解最新行业动态,洞察平台工程本质。
欢迎平台工程师们 关注 & 参与!
版权声明: 本文为 InfoQ 作者【杨振涛】的原创文章。
原文链接:【http://xie.infoq.cn/article/3a2c946a12f61de10138c3ed4】。
本文遵守【CC BY-NC-ND】协议,转载请保留原文出处及本版权声明。
评论